I'm on a Philip K. Dick kick lately.  If you like droning analog synth and the relentless key of C in the 4/4, then you may enjoy this. All tracks but drums are live played and then edited but no sequencing.  I used my trusty Yamaha CS-5 analog monophonic with my filteriffic Moog Concertmate (from Radio Shack circa 1980) and the evil Akai Minac for necessary piano and organ sounds and the same Roland drum beat I recycle when I'm feeling lazy.
